Super fun middle grade fantasy book. There are lots of fantasy books about wizards, witches, dragons, fairies, etc. Brandon Mull did something so different and unique with a book about magical candy. Young readers will love the ways this book opens up the imagination and will wish they could eat some magical candy of their own.

A fun, quick YA middle school level read. 4 kids get involved with an old lady who gives them magical candy in exchange for doing tasks for her. Mull pulls together the story well at the end.
